Web20 feb. 2024 · Set Up Your Slideshow to Be Looped. First, open your PowerPoint presentation in which you would like to loop. Once open, navigate to the “Set Up” group of the “Slide Show” tab and then select the “Set Up Slide Show” button. Anything that you can add to an individual slide can be added to the Slide Master. To add recurring text to each slide, follow this procedure: WebThere are many ways to do this. Here’s the easiest one: select any slide and press Ctrl + M in Windows, or Cmd + M in Mac. A new slide will be created with the same design as the one you selected. You can also select any slide, go to the toolbar and click on the “+” button, located in the top-left corner of the screen.
